客服联系方式

当前位置:首页 » 论文摘要 » 正文

论文摘要:嵌入式Linux视频传输系统的设计与实现

9417 人参与  2022年01月30日 22:28  分类 : 论文摘要  评论

视频传输系统面临着数据量大,实时性高,处理算法复杂等难题,尤其是在资源相对缺乏的嵌入式平台和带宽有限、信道不稳定的无线网络中,如何提高视频处理效率和传输质量成为无线视频传输系统关注的主要问题。本文在Intel XScale PXA270嵌入式Linux平台上,采用MPEG-4视频编码技术,设计并实现了一种基于802.11无线局域网的实时视频传输系统。为了提高视频处理效率和网络传输质量,本文从系统平台、视频采集、压缩编码、网络传输和视频播放五个方面对系统进行了设计改进。在系统平台部分,视频传输系统采用多任务并发和共享缓冲区机制提高系统整体性能,为了保证任务调度的实时性,在Linux平台上构建了RTAI实时系统,实现EDF软实时调度算法。在视频采集部分,通过FIQ快速中断优化USB主控制器DMA数据传输,并采用OV511硬件压缩技术,加速视频采集过程。在压缩编码部分,针对嵌入式硬件平台资源有限以及无线网络带宽不稳定的特点,基于Intel IPP 集成性能函数库,设计并实现了具有码率控制功能的MPEG-4视频编解码器。在网络传输部分,为了解决无线传输过程中的延时、丢包、乱序等问题,基于RTP/RTCP实时传输协议,在发送方设计了针对MPEG-4视频的分组发送策略,在接收方设计了一种基于环形缓冲区的视频分组接收机制。为了避免由于无线链路状态不稳定而引发的拥塞问题,发送方采用了流量自适应控制机制,根据网络状态动态调整视频码率和发送参数,来达到视频传输质量的最优化效果。在视频播放部分,采用Linux FrameBuffer图像显示接口,通过LCD硬件控制器的图层叠加和图像格式转换功能,提高视频播放性能。基于以上设计与实现方案,通过实验测试表明,在320 x 240图像分辨率下,视频端对端无线传输速率达到了25帧/秒,网络延时控制在300ms以内,CPU占用率在50%左右。

来源:半壳优胜育转载请保留出处和链接!

本文链接:http://87cpy.com/207645.html

云彩店APP下载
云彩店APP下载

本站部分内容来源网络如有侵权请联系删除

<< 上一篇 下一篇 >>

  • 评论(0)
  • 赞助本站

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

站内导航

足球简报

篮球简报

云彩店邀请码54967

    云彩店app|云彩店邀请码|云彩店下载|半壳|优胜

NBA | CBA | 中超 | 亚冠 | 英超 | 德甲 | 西甲 | 法甲 | 意甲 | 欧冠 | 欧洲杯 | 冬奥会 | 残奥会 | 世界杯 | 比赛直播 |

Copyright 半壳优胜体育 Rights Reserved.